(19-Feb-2018, 00:39)midi Wrote: If you want something to store your music and if you want to eliminate a computer in your chain, you can use an INNUOS Server. You can run the INNUOS with ROON Core or as a ROON player. There a only some limitations with DSD.
My INNUOS is running perfect with ROON Core and sounds great (via USB).
But to be honest, for the moment I think I will not go with ROON run lifetime, because the TIDAL limitation regarding the price is a no go. I tried Spotify Connect and it´s sounds really good. I don´t believe anyone could here a big difference. And Spotify Connect is really comfortable and fast.
For the local music you can use iPeng or a good UPnP app (like AK Connect 2.0 f.e).
